Connecting to the Internet
Internet connection is a must for you to work on Chromebook. Connect
to the Internet wirelessly using a Wi-Fi connection.
Enabling your Wi-Fi connection
To enable your Wi-Fi connection:
1.
Launch the status area.
Select No networks to automatically enable your Wi-Fi
2.
connection.
Switching to a new Wi-Fi network connection
By default, your Chromebook uses the Wi-Fi network you chose during
the setup process when you used your device for the first time. In case
you need to choose a new network connection, refer to the following
steps:
1.
Launch the status area.
2.
Select your current Wi-Fi network connection.
3.
Select your new Wi-Fi network connection from the current list of
networks then type in the corresponding password, if necessary.
